'JD Vance understood': Shashi Tharoor in US on Operation Sindoor; says 'India won the narrative
Posted
Shashi Tharoor said that US vice president JD Vance understands the impossibility of mediating between India and Pakistan, as it would imply an equivalence between a victim and a terrorist. Tharoor highlighted India's strong diplomatic outreach, noting more meetings at higher levels compared to the Pakistani delegation. He also emphasised the unity within India regarding the issue of terrorism.
